软件开发团队技术能力评价体系.docxVIP

  1. 1、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
  2. 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  3. 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
  4. 4、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
  5. 5、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们
  6. 6、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
  7. 7、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多

软件开发团队技术能力评价体系

一、评价体系的核心价值与构建原则

构建软件开发团队技术能力评价体系,其根本目的在于赋能团队成长、优化资源配置、提升交付效能并降低技术风险。它不应仅仅是一种绩效考核的工具,更应成为团队成员职业发展的导航图和团队整体技术战略落地的晴雨表。

在设计和实施评价体系时,应遵循以下基本原则:

1.客观性与全面性原则:评价应基于可观察、可衡量的事实和数据,避免主观臆断。同时,需覆盖技术能力的多个维度,避免以偏概全。

2.导向性与发展性原则:评价指标应引导团队关注真正重要的能力提升方向,并鼓励持续学习与创新,而非简单地进行优劣划分。

3.可操作性与实用性原则:评价体系应简洁明了,指标应易于理解和获取数据,评价过程应高效可行,能够真正为决策提供支持。

4.动态调整与适应性原则:技术领域发展迅速,评价体系也应定期审视和调整,以适应组织战略、业务需求和技术趋势的变化。

二、技术能力评价的关键维度

软件开发团队的技术能力是一个系统工程,我们可以从以下几个核心维度进行解构与评价:

(一)人员技能与素养

团队是由个体组成的,成员的技能水平和综合素养是团队技术能力的基础。

*专业技术知识:这包括编程语言、框架、工具、数据库、中间件等的掌握程度和应用熟练度。评价时需结合团队当前技术栈和未来发展方向,考察成员知识的广度与深度。

*工程实践能力:编码规范的遵循、代码质量(可读性、可维护性、性能)、单元测试与集成测试能力、持续集成/持续部署(CI/CD)实践、问题定位与调试能力、重构能力等。

*学习与成长能力:技术敏感度、新知识/新技术的学习意愿和能力、知识分享与沉淀的积极性、从实践中总结经验教训的能力。

*问题解决与创新能力:面对复杂技术难题时的分析思路、解决方案的合理性与创新性、跳出固有思维模式的能力。

*沟通协作与责任担当:跨角色(如与产品、测试)沟通的清晰度和效率、团队内部协作的顺畅度、对交付成果的责任心、以及在项目压力下的表现。

(二)技术过程与实践

高效、规范的技术过程是保证产品质量和交付效率的关键。

*需求分析与规划能力:准确理解业务需求并将其转化为技术方案的能力、技术可行性评估能力、合理规划技术实现路径和资源投入的能力。

*架构设计与技术选型能力:系统架构的合理性、可扩展性、可维护性、安全性设计;在众多技术方案中选择最适合当前业务场景和团队能力的技术栈的判断力。

*研发流程成熟度:是否采用敏捷、看板等适合团队的开发方法论;需求管理、任务拆解、代码review、版本控制、缺陷管理等流程的规范性和执行效果。

*工具链与自动化水平:代码管理工具、构建工具、测试工具、部署工具、监控告警工具的使用情况;自动化测试(单元、接口、UI)、自动化部署的覆盖率和有效性。

*质量保障体系:是否建立了完善的测试策略(功能、性能、安全、兼容性等);缺陷预防和快速响应机制;代码质量门禁的执行情况。

(三)交付成果与质量

团队的技术能力最终要通过交付的产品或服务来体现。

*产品/项目质量:功能完整性与准确性、系统稳定性与可靠性(如MTBF、故障率)、性能指标(响应时间、吞吐量、资源利用率)、安全性(漏洞数量、防护措施)、用户体验中的技术支撑。

*技术债务管理:对技术债务的识别、评估、记录和偿还策略;是否存在因短期交付压力而牺牲长期代码质量的情况。

*交付效率与响应速度:迭代周期、从需求提出到上线的平均时长、紧急修复的响应速度和解决效率。

*文档与知识沉淀:系统设计文档、API文档、用户手册、运维手册等的完整性、准确性和易理解性;团队内部技术知识库的建设和使用情况。

(四)团队协作与技术文化

健康的技术文化和高效的团队协作是技术能力持续提升的土壤。

*团队沟通与知识共享:团队内部信息传递的透明度和及时性;是否有常态化的技术分享、经验交流机制(如技术例会、分享会、内部培训)。

*技术创新与改进氛围:团队是否鼓励尝试新技术、新方法;是否有机制收集和采纳成员的改进建议;对失败的容忍度和从失败中学习的能力。

*团队凝聚力与战斗力:成员对团队目标的认同感;面对挑战时的团队协作精神和攻坚能力;内部竞争与合作的平衡。

*技术决策机制:技术决策过程是否民主、透明;是否基于数据和事实进行决策;决策的执行与反馈闭环。

三、评价方法与实施路径

有了评价维度和指标,还需要合适的评价方法和实施路径来确保体系落地。

1.多元数据采集:

*主观评价:如自评互评、上级评价、360度反馈等,用于评估沟通协作、学习能力等难以量化的维度。

*客观数据:如代码质量metrics(复杂度、重复率、测试覆盖率)、缺陷密度、构建成功率、部署频率、线上故

文档评论(0)

csg3997 + 关注
实名认证
文档贡献者

该用户很懒,什么也没介绍

1亿VIP精品文档

相关文档